FreshBooks vs. Zoho Books: Which Accounting Software Is Right for Your Business?
Choosing the right accounting software is an important decision for any business. The platform you select affects invoicing, expense tracking, reporting, tax prep, and day-to-day financial management. For freelancers, service businesses, and growing small companies, FreshBooks and Zoho Books are two of the most common options.
Both tools can streamline accounting tasks, but they are built with different users in mind. This comparison of FreshBooks vs. Zoho Books breaks down the key differences so you can choose the one that better fits your workflow, budget, and growth plans.
Why This Comparison Matters
Accounting software is more than a bookkeeping tool. It can save time, reduce errors, improve cash flow, and give you a clearer picture of business performance. If you are switching platforms or choosing software for the first time, it helps to understand where each product is strongest.
The right choice often depends on questions like:
- Do you want the simplest possible setup?
- Do you bill clients for time and services?
- Do you sell physical products and need inventory features?
- Do you want software that integrates with a broader business suite?
- How much accounting complexity does your business need today?
FreshBooks and Zoho Books both serve small businesses well, but they are not interchangeable. Here is how they compare.
FreshBooks: Best for Simplicity and Service-Based Businesses
FreshBooks is designed with freelancers, consultants, agencies, and other service-based businesses in mind. Its biggest strength is ease of use. The interface is clean, the setup is straightforward, and everyday tasks are easy to learn even if you are not experienced with accounting software.
What FreshBooks does
FreshBooks focuses on invoicing, time tracking, expense management, project organization, and basic accounting reporting. It is especially useful for businesses that bill clients for hours worked or services delivered.
Why businesses choose it
FreshBooks makes it easy to create professional invoices, track billable time, send payment reminders, and accept online payments. For service businesses, that can mean faster billing and better cash flow. Its project features also help connect invoices, expenses, and time entries to specific client work.
Best fit
FreshBooks is a strong choice for:
- Freelancers
- Consultants
- Designers
- Agencies
- Small service businesses
- New business owners who want a simple accounting tool
Pros
- Clean, intuitive interface
- Strong invoicing tools
- Built-in time tracking
- Useful project organization features
- Helpful customer support
Cons
- Limited inventory management
- More basic reporting than some competitors
- Can feel restrictive as businesses become more complex
Zoho Books: Best for Growing Businesses and Integrated Workflows
Zoho Books is part of the larger Zoho business software ecosystem. It offers a broader accounting feature set and is built for businesses that want more than invoicing and basic expense tracking. If you want accounting software that can connect with CRM, project management, inventory, and other business tools, Zoho Books is designed for that kind of workflow.
What Zoho Books does
Zoho Books handles invoicing, expense tracking, bank reconciliation, inventory, project billing, reporting, purchase orders, and multi-currency transactions. Its value grows even more when paired with other Zoho apps.
Why businesses choose it
Zoho Books works well as a central financial hub. It gives businesses more control over accounting processes and offers features that are especially useful for companies with more operational complexity. If your team already uses Zoho products, the integration can reduce manual work and improve visibility across departments.
Best fit
Zoho Books is a strong choice for:
- Small to medium-sized businesses
- Product-based businesses
- Companies with inventory needs
- Businesses that work across currencies
- Teams already using Zoho apps
- Businesses looking for a more scalable accounting platform
Pros
- Broad accounting feature set
- Inventory management
- Multi-currency support
- Strong integration with Zoho apps
- Good automation options
- Scales well as business needs grow
Cons
- Slightly steeper learning curve
- Interface can feel more crowded than FreshBooks
- Best value is often tied to using the Zoho ecosystem
- Support experiences can vary
FreshBooks vs. Zoho Books: Key Differences
Ease of Use
FreshBooks is the easier platform to learn. Its layout is simple and the workflow is built for quick adoption.
Zoho Books is still user-friendly, but it includes more options and deeper functionality. That makes it more powerful, but also a little more involved at the start.
Winner: FreshBooks for simplicity
Core Features
FreshBooks is strongest in invoicing, time tracking, client billing, and basic project management. It is a great fit for service-based businesses that mainly need to bill clients and track work.
Zoho Books offers a broader accounting feature set, including inventory management, purchase orders, bank reconciliation, and more advanced reporting.
Winner: Zoho Books for feature depth
Business Type
FreshBooks is best suited to service businesses that bill for time and expertise. If your work revolves around clients, projects, and invoices, it fits naturally.
Zoho Books is better for businesses that need more complete accounting support, especially those selling products or managing more complex operations.
Winner: Depends on your business model
Integrations
Zoho Books stands out if you already use other Zoho tools. The ability to connect with Zoho CRM, Zoho Projects, and Zoho Inventory creates a more connected workflow.
FreshBooks offers integrations too, but its main appeal is not ecosystem depth. It is better for businesses that want a focused accounting tool rather than a full business platform.
Winner: Zoho Books
Scalability
FreshBooks can absolutely support growing service businesses, but it may feel limiting if your needs expand into product sales, advanced reporting, or more detailed accounting processes.
Zoho Books is generally the stronger option for long-term growth because it offers more room to expand into additional features and workflows.
Winner: Zoho Books
Pricing and Value
Both platforms use tiered pricing, so the real question is not just cost, but value.
FreshBooks pricing
FreshBooks typically offers several plan levels, with pricing that reflects features such as the number of billable clients and access to advanced tools. It is often attractive to freelancers and small service teams because it focuses on core functionality without unnecessary complexity.
Zoho Books pricing
Zoho Books also offers multiple tiers, usually with more features included at each level. That can make it a strong value for businesses that will actually use the broader toolset. If you are already using other Zoho applications, the combined value can be especially strong.
How to evaluate value
Consider these factors:
- Are you paying for features you will not use?
- Could Zoho Books replace other tools in your stack?
- Would FreshBooks save time through a simpler workflow?
- How much will your costs rise as you grow?
- Which platform fits your day-to-day needs today, not just in theory?
Which Should You Choose?
Choose FreshBooks if:
- You are a freelancer or consultant
- You invoice clients for services
- You want the simplest setup possible
- Time tracking is important
- You prefer a clean, easy-to-use interface
Choose Zoho Books if:
- You need inventory management
- You sell products as well as services
- You want deeper accounting features
- You use or plan to use other Zoho tools
- You need a platform that can scale with a growing business
Frequently Asked Questions
Which is better for freelancers?
FreshBooks is usually the better fit for freelancers because it is easy to use and built around invoicing, time tracking, and client billing.
Does Zoho Books have inventory management?
Yes. Zoho Books includes inventory features, making it a better option for businesses that sell physical products.
Which has better customer support?
Both platforms are generally well reviewed, but FreshBooks is often praised for especially responsive and helpful support.
Can I use both FreshBooks and Zoho Books?
It is possible, but not usually recommended. Running two accounting systems can lead to duplication, confusion, and extra costs.
How do they handle taxes?
Both platforms help you track income and expenses and generate reports that support tax preparation. They are useful tools, but they do not replace professional tax advice.
Can these platforms scale with my business?
Yes, but in different ways. FreshBooks works well for growing service businesses, while Zoho Books is typically the stronger option for businesses that need more advanced accounting and broader operational support.
Conclusion
The better choice in FreshBooks vs. Zoho Books depends on your business model and how much accounting complexity you need.
If you want a simple, user-friendly platform for invoicing, time tracking, and client work, FreshBooks is often the better match. It is especially appealing to freelancers and service businesses that want to keep accounting straightforward.
If you need a more complete accounting system with inventory, multi-currency support, deeper reporting, and strong integrations, Zoho Books is the stronger option. It is especially well suited to growing businesses and companies already using the Zoho ecosystem.
The best way to decide is to try both platforms. Test the interface, review the features that matter most to your business, and see which one fits your daily workflow more naturally.